One of the relocatable kernel support patches assumes that the target
address will be 0. But for kdump kernels (without relocation support) it
will be 32MB. The following patch fixes this issue.
Fix kdump kernel issue
Kdump kernel without relocation support needs to be moved to
PHYSICAL_START (ie 32MB) instead of 0. This patch fixes this
issue.

Hmmm. Is there any reason to continue to support non-relocatable
64-bit kernels being kdump kernels? In other words, for 64-bit,
couldn't we make CONFIG_CRASH_DUMP depend on CONFIG_RELOCATABLE?
I don't think we want to try to support two different modes of
operation for a kdump kernel, and I don't see any value in continuing
to support PHYSICAL_START > 0 for 64-bit non-relocatable kernels.
(And when we can make 32-bit PIE kernels, I'll be making the same
statement about 32-bit. :)

We wanted to support legacy kdump feature on 64 bit kernels for some
time. But if nobody needs the legacy kdump, we can make kdump depend on
relocatable
